Emotional Wellbeing on the Path to Parenthood: Understanding IVF's Impact

Embarking towards the journey to parenthood can be an joyful experience, filled with anticipation and dreams of starting a unit. For people who choose in vitro fertilization (IVF) as their path toward achieving pregnancy, the emotional landscape can be particularly diverse. IVF is a mentally demanding process that often requires multiple attempts, each with its own set of challenges.

The emotional ups and downs of IVF can significantly impact a person's emotional wellbeing. Experiencing hormonal fluctuations, medical interventions, and the vagueness surrounding treatment outcomes can lead feelings of anxiety, depression, and frustration. Additionally, the social pressures associated with infertility and parenthood can add more layer of difficulty to this already challenging journey.

It is crucial for couples undergoing IVF to prioritize their emotional wellbeing by receiving help. Connecting with a therapist, joining a support group, or confiding in loved ones can provide essential emotional outlet. Remember, your emotional health is just as significant as your physical health on this path to parenthood.
